    Abstract: The invention relates to a method for the production of film rear-injected plastic moulded parts from a film and a long-fiber reinforced plastic material, wherein the film is positioned in a forming tool and rear-injected with a plastic material reinforced by a fiber material in order to produce a moulded part. Prior to rear injection, the plastic material and the fiber material are added together in an extruder or an injection moulding machine which has at least one distributive mixing element in an area adjacent to the compression zone, melted and mixed. The invention also relates to moulded parts which can be obtained according to the above-mentioned method.

    Abstract: The invention relates to moldings encompassing a composite layered sheet or composite layered film and a backing layer made from plastic injection-molded, foamed, or cast onto the back of the material, where the composite layered sheet or composite layered film encompasses (1) a substrate layer comprising, based on the total of the amounts of components A and B, and, where appropriate, C and/or D, which give 100% by weight in total, a from 1-99% by weight of an elastomeric graft copolymer as component A, b from 1-99% by weight of one or more hard copolymers containing units which derive from vinylaromatic monomers, as component B, c from 0-80% by weight of polycarbonates, as component C, and d from 0-50% by weight of fibrous or particulate fillers, or a mixture of these, as component D, Wherein component B contains, based us the total weight of units deriving from vinylaromatic monomers, from 40-100% by weight of units deriving from alpha-methylstyrene and from 0-60% by weight of units deriving from styrene. The invention further relates to a process for producing these moldings, to their use as bodywork components or motor vehicles, and also to motor vehicle bodywork components comprising these moldings.
